China home prices snap three-month drop

Bloomberg Chinese home prices rose in more cities in October, snapping a three-month decline, a sign the market is stabilising amid government efforts to curb property speculation. New-home prices, excluding state-subsidised housing, climbed in 50 of the 70 cities tracked by the government, compared with 44 in September, the National Bureau of Statistics said.
